Hi Im using an 8 inch celestron with hyperstar lens, zw0 1600 colour camera and light pollution filters ( as I live in a light polluted city). When I try the colour calibration the background goes crazy. I get a green background on one filter and a red one on the other. Is there a way to do the colour calibration such that Pixinsihgt knows you are using  filter and compensates. What suggestions are there for getting the right colour in these cases? or should I just miss this step when using filters?

your background tolerance level might be set wrong. you can experiment with the BackgroundNeutralization process to find the right tolerance value. when you have found a tolerance large enough the background of the image after BN (and a channel-locked STF application) should be black/grey.
